Skip to main content

GitHub AE es una versión limitada en este momento.

Configurar una fuente de publicación para tu sitio de Páginas de GitHub

Si usas la fuente de publicación predeterminada para tu sitio de GitHub Pages, este se publicará automáticamente. También puedes elegir publicar tu sitio desde otra rama o carpeta.

Quién puede usar esta característica

People with admin or maintainer permissions for a repository can configure a publishing source for a GitHub Pages site.

GitHub Pages está disponible en repositorios internos y privados con GitHub AE. GitHub Pages se encuentra disponible en los repositorios públicos con GitHub Free y con GitHub Free para las organizaciones, y en los repositorios públicos y privados con GitHub Pro, GitHub Team, GitHub Enterprise Cloud, y GitHub Enterprise Server.

Acerca de las fuentes de publicación

Tu sitio de GitHub Pages se publicará cuando se inserten cambios en una rama específica. Puedes especificar qué rama y carpeta usar como origen de publicación. La rama de origen puede ser cualquier rama del repositorio y la carpeta de origen puede ser la raíz del repositorio (/) de la rama de origen o una carpeta /docs de la rama de origen. Cuando se insertan cambios en la rama de origen, los cambios en la carpeta de origen se publicarán en el sitio de GitHub Pages.

Advertencia: Los sitios de GitHub Pages son visibles para todos los miembros de la empresa, incluso si el repositorio del sitio es privado. Si tienes datos confidenciales en el repositorio del sitio, tal vez te interese eliminarlos antes de publicarlo. Para obtener más información, vea «Acerca de los repositorios».

Publicación desde una rama

  1. Asegúrate de que la rama que quieres utilizar como fuente de publicación ya exista en tu repositorio.

  2. En GitHub AE, navega al repositorio de tu sitio.

  3. En el nombre del repositorio, haz clic en Configuración. Si no puedes ver la pestaña "Configuración", selecciona el menú desplegable y, a continuación, haz clic en Configuración. Captura de pantalla de un encabezado de repositorio en el que se muestran las pestañas. La pestaña "Configuración" está resaltada con un contorno naranja oscuro.

  4. En la sección "Código y automatización" de la barra lateral, haz clic en Páginas.

  5. En "GitHub Pages", usa el menú desplegable de rama y selecciona un origen de publicación. Captura de pantalla de la configuración de Páginas en un repositorio GitHub. El menú para seleccionar una rama como origen de publicación, etiquetado como "Ninguno", aparece en naranja oscuro.

  6. Opcionalmente, utiliza el menú desplegable de carpeta para seleccionar una carpeta para tu origen de publicación. Captura de pantalla de la configuración de Páginas en un repositorio GitHub. El menú para seleccionar una carpeta como origen de publicación, etiquetado como "/(root)", aparece en naranja oscuro.

  7. Haga clic en Save(Guardar).

Solución de problemas de publicación desde una rama

Notas:

  • If el sitio no se ha publicado automáticamente, asegúrate de que alguien con permisos de administrador y una dirección de correo electrónico verificada haya insertado en la fuente de publicación.

  • Las confirmaciones insertadas por un flujo de trabajo de GitHub Actions que usa GITHUB_TOKEN no desencadenan una compilación de GitHub Pages.

Si elige la carpeta docs en cualquier rama como origen de publicación y después quita la carpeta /docs de esa rama en el repositorio, el sitio no se compilará y obtendrá un mensaje de error de compilación de página sobre una carpeta /docs que falta. Para obtener más información, vea «Solucionar problemas de errores de compilación de Jekyll para sitios de Páginas de GitHub».